Birthdays were always a big deal in our house. We loved the excitement, the joy of picking out the perfect gifts, and the sparkle in our daughter’s eyes when she tore off the wrapping paper. But this year, as our daughter turned ten, her birthday took an unexpected turn—one we never saw coming.

The Morning Surprise

My wife and I woke up on the morning of her birthday feeling excited. We’d planned everything perfectly—balloons, cake, her favorite dinner, and, of course, presents we had carefully chosen over the past few weeks. One of them was an iPhone—not the latest model, but still a great first phone. We knew she’d been wanting one for a while, and though it wasn’t easy for us financially, we wanted to make her feel special.

But instead of waking up to joyful giggles and an excited child eager for her birthday breakfast, we walked into chaos.

There, in the middle of the living room, was our daughter. Wrapping paper was shredded all over the floor. Boxes had been ripped open and tossed aside like they meant nothing. Every single gift, including the iPhone, had already been unwrapped.

At first, we were shocked. She had never done something like this before. But what made it worse—what absolutely broke us—was her reaction.

“These Are Worthless!”

Instead of happiness, our daughter looked disappointed. No, not just disappointed—furious. She turned to us, crossing her arms with a scowl, and yelled:

“These are WORTHLESS! They’re OLD! I don’t even need them!”

We stood there, speechless. My wife’s face fell, and I could feel my own heart pounding in my chest. We had worked so hard to make this birthday special, sacrificing, saving up, making sure every gift was something she would enjoy. And yet, here she was—ungrateful, dismissive, and angry.

Her words stung.

“Did we raise her like this?”
“Where did we go wrong?”

We didn’t even know what to say. After a few tense moments, we simply walked away, feeling defeated.

A Lesson in Gratitude

The next morning, she came downstairs, rubbing her eyes.

“Where are my presents?” she asked.

I took a deep breath and calmly said, “We sold them.”

She froze.

“What?!”

“You said you didn’t need them,” I continued. “So, we got rid of them.”

The tantrum that followed could probably be heard from space. She screamed. She stomped her feet. She threw herself on the floor, wailing about how we had ruined her life.

I let her cry it out. When she finally calmed down, I sat her down and looked her in the eye.

“Do you understand now?” I asked. “Do you realize what you did yesterday? We spent time and money getting you things we thought you’d love, and instead of being happy, you threw them aside like trash. Gifts are not something you’re entitled to. They’re something to be grateful for.”

Tears welled up in her eyes.

We let her sit with that lesson for the rest of the day. By dinner time, she had apologized, promising she would never act that way again. That night, after she went to bed, we retrieved the gifts from the garage and wrapped them up again.

The Real Gift

The next morning, she woke up to find her presents back under the tree. This time, she opened them slowly, her face filled with genuine happiness. She hugged us tight and whispered, “Thank you.”

Sometimes, the best gift isn’t something wrapped in a box—it’s a lesson that lasts a lifetime.

So, did we do the right thing? I think so. Because today, my daughter learned the true meaning of gratitude.
